Description

Some of the plates printed on both sides.


Each part has a special t.-p. and separate paging; the special title pages vary slightly from the titles as quoted from the general t.-p.


Contents: A few words on the Huntingdon family (p. XV-XXIII)--1. The charters and royal grants with seals from A. D. 1101 to 1688.--II. Historical correspondence from time of King Henry VIII to death of Queen Elizabeth, A.D. 1513 to 1608.---III. Historical correspondence during reign of King James I, A. D. 1608-1625.--IV. America: Sir Walter Raleigh, 1597-1618; the Virginia company, 1610-1625; Florida, 1767-8; and war for independence, 1776.--V. Historical correspondence from time of Charles I to flight of James II, A. D. 1625 to 1687.--VI. Historical correspondence relating to Scotland, the Old and Young Pretenders, and the rebellions of 1715 and 1745.
